Camstar Mes Program Manager

Location: Cincinnati, OH - Onsite

Fulltime

Must Have Technical/Functional Skills

Managed programs for Manufacturing domains in MES (Preferred managed programs in Siemens Camstar / Siemens Opcenter Core platform)

Complete life cycle implementation of Manufacturing Execution Systems (MES)

Strategize, implement, and maintain program initiatives that adhere to schedule

Roles & Responsibilities

Program Management: Manages key initiating, planning, executing, controlling, and closing processes; develops and implements project plan; builds team ownership and commitment to project plan

Work closely with project sponsors and cross-functional teams to develop the scope, deliverables, required resources, work plan, budget, and timing for new initiatives

Managing workforce and resource allocation

Analyze, evaluate, and overcome program risks, and produce program reports for managers and stakeholders

Identifies and manages project dependencies and critical path items while ensuring project quality and utilizing and following appropriate methodologies. Assures project quality by using standard development methodologies.

Communicating and collaborating with program stakeholders

Assessing a program's pros and cons

Be a mentor, ability to train other associates in the required skills

Ensure the quality of deliverable by working with assurance team

Conducts project postmortems and communicates lessons learned in order to identify successful and unsuccessful project elements.

Understanding of ANSI/ISA-95 Manufacturing Operations Model

Understanding of functionalities in Manufacturing Execution Systems
